February Routine

Our February routine is a fairly predictable one.

Get up, let the dog out, stoke the wood burning stoves, do office chores, if we have guests- make breakfast and feed the guests, feed the horses and haul a 6 gallon water can of hot water to their water tank. Back to the inside and work on chores around the place, until it gets dark and we feed the horses again.  Watch a movie while eating dinner.  Read, stoke the fires, go to bed.

No horseback riding in that list.  Limited outdoor activity, period.  With the temperatures running from 0 to the low 30's, and the wind blowing a lot of the time, neither us nor the horses are too thrilled with the prospect of saddling up and going for a trudge.

Get up, let the dog out, stoke the wood burning stoves...

Who was the genius that decided we should add the extra day in leap year to FEBRUARY?
